Kareena Kapoor’s enduring footprint in entertainment content and popular media lies in her refusal to follow traditional industry timelines. Historically, the careers of mainstream Indian actresses faced steep declines post-marriage or post-motherhood. Kapoor openly rejected this convention, actively filming through pregnancies and securing some of her biggest box-office hits in her late 30s and 40s. kareena kapoor xxx videos

Early in her career, Kapoor rejected the conventional glamorous trajectory by starring in Chameli (2004), playing a street-smart sex worker, and Dev (2004), a drama centered on communal riots. Her performance as the tragic, complex Dolly Mishra in Vishal Bhardwaj’s Omkara (2006)—an adaptation of Shakespeare's Othello —solidified her status as a powerhouse dramatic actor.

Before the early 2000s, mainstream Bollywood frequently relegated female leads to passive, decorative roles designed to support the male protagonist. Kapoor disrupted this template. Through her portrayal of vibrant, flawed, and deeply expressive characters, she introduced a new vocabulary for the Hindi film heroine.
Kapoor created characters that entered the cultural lexicon. Her portrayal of "Poo" in Kabhi Khushi Kabhie Gham... (2001) redefined modern femininity in Indian cinema. The character became a prototype for the confident, fashion-forward, unapologetic urban woman. Decades later, Poo dominates internet memes and TikTok recreations. Similarly, her role as Geet in Jab We Met (2007) altered the romantic comedy genre. Geet’s self-love philosophy shifted how writers crafted female protagonists. The most significant shift in media consumption arrived with OTT, and Kareena marked her digital debut with a bang. In 2023, she starred in Jaane Jaan , the Hindi adaptation of the acclaimed Japanese novel The Devotion of Suspect X , on Netflix. The crime thriller was not just a success; it was a phenomenon.
